Randomized study of Taxane vs TS-1 in metastatic or recurrent breast cancer patients

Randomized study of Taxane vs TS-1 in metastatic or recurrent breast cancer patients - Selection of effective chemotherapy for breast cancer (SELECT BC)

Conditions

Metastatic or recurrent breast cancer

Interventions

Taxane arm is given one administration chosen from below three pattern of administration by doctor. We repeat it 6 cycles or till cancer becomes worse. (1) Dosetaxel 60-75mg/m2 (one cycle: 3 or 4 we

Eligibility

Sex/Gender
Female

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1)Histologically proven breast cancer 2)(a)Distant metastasis (Stage IV) in first diagnosis or (b) Proven metastatic or recurrent breast cancer after treatment by distant metastasis 3)At least one assessable lesion 4)No prior chemotherapy 5)ECOG performance status 0-1 6)(a)No prior Taxane administration or (b)Having passed at least 6 months since last Taxane administration 7)(a)No prior 5-FU administration or (b)Having passed more than 6 months since last 5-FU administration 8)Having passed more than 7 days since last hormonal therapy and more than 14 days since last radiation therapy 9)(a)Estrogen receptor(-) and progesterone receptor(-) in test of primary or recurrent lesion, (b) Ineffective primary hormonal therapy after metastasis or recurrence or (c)Metastasis or recurrence during postoperative adjuvant hormone therapy or within 6 months after last hormone therapy 10)Neutrophilic leukocyte>=1,500 or WBC>=3,000, PLT>=100,000, T-B<=(every institution's reference value)*2.5, AST(GOT)<=(every institution's reference value)*2.5, CRE<=(every institution's reference value) (these values are examined within 21 days before registration for this study) 11)No cardiac disease or no limitation of physical activity due to cardiac disease 12)Written informed consent

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1)During pregnancy or lactation, or planning to get pregnant 2)HER2(Her2/neu, Erb B2) IHC (3+) or FISH(fluorescence in situ hybridization) (+) at primary or metastatic lesion 3)Anaphylaxis against medicine or solvent of this protocol treatment 4)Active double cancers 5)Brain metastasis which needs treatment for hyperfunction of intracranial pressure or urgent irradiation 6)Extended liver metastasis or lymphatic lung metastasis with dyspnea 7)Only one assessable lesion having past radiation therapy 8)Retention of pleural fluid, ascites and pericardial fluid which need urgent treatment 9)Active infectious disease 10)Interstitial pneumonia or idiopathic interstitial pneumonia 11)HBs(+) 12)Diabetes mellitus in bad control or during insulin treatment 13)Mental disease with difficulty of taking part in this study 14)Patients judged inappropriate for this study by the physicians

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Overall Survival

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Progression-Free Survival Time To Treatment Failure Adverse Events Hearth-Related QOL Efficacy of medical economy
